INTRODUCTION: FRAC GROUP M5 FUNGICIDES (multi-site contact activity) Chlorothalonil is a dinitrile that isbenzene-1,3-dicarbonitrile substituted by four chloro groups. A non-systemic fungicide first introduced in the 1960s,itis used to control a range of diseases in a wide variety of crops. It has a role as an antifungal agrochemical. It is adinitrile, a tetrachlorobenzene and an aromatic fungicide. It is functionally related to an isophthalonitrile.Chlorothalonil is a natural product found in Curcuma longa with data available Fungicide, bactericide, nematocide.Agricultural and horticultural fungicide Chlorothalonil is a non-systemic fungicide. It is used predominantly onpeanuts, potatoes, and tomatoes. It is also used on golf courses and lawns and as an additive in some paints

USAGES: Used as a fungicide on vegetables, trees, fruits, turf, ornamentals, and other crops; [EXTOXNET] Used as a fungicideand preservative in paints, adhesives, and wood; [Kanerva, p. 786] Used as a biocide in paint; [Adams, p. 475] Used asa preservative in adhesives; [HSDB] Act mainly as a fungicide and mildewicide, but possesses some bactericidal,microbicidal, algaecidal, insecticidal, and acaricidal properties; Used as broad spectrum non-systemic pesticide,mildewicide for paints and other surface treatments, and protectant for wood; Contains hexachlorobenzene (HCB) asan impurity Fungicide on a variety of vegetable crops, peanuts, lawns & turfs Chlorothalonil (2,4,5,6-tetrachloroisophthalonitrile) is an organic compound mainly used as a broad spectrum, nonsystemic fungicide, withother uses as a wood protectant, pesticide, acaricide, and to control mold, mildew, bacteria, algae
